Relational Databases Editorial Review
**** "Database in Depth: Relational Theory for Practitioners" by C.J. Date serves as a deep dive into the principles of relational databases, aimed at practitioners who are already familiar with SQL. It strikes a delicate balance between theoretical concepts and practical application, helping readers understand the fundamentals that underpin relational database systems. Many readers praise Date's clear writing and the way he articulates complex concepts such as normalization, integrity Constraints, and relational algebra, making them accessible even for those without extensive mathematical backgrounds. However, the book does exhibit a few shortcomings. Some reviewers noted that the editing could be better, particularly criticizing the frequent use of forward references that can disrupt the flow of reading. Additionally, while it offers an informal, conversational style, this might not provide the rigorous technical foundation some readers expect. The lack of in-depth mathematical treatment and more structured explanations sometimes leaves readers wanting more. Despite these critiques, the Consensus remains that for those who already possess a basic understanding of databases and wish to deepen their knowledge, "Database in Depth" is a valuable resource. The insights offered can lead to better database designs and an awareness of common pitfalls in database management. Readers who are prepared to engage with the material intellectually will find this book a worthwhile addition to their library, continuing to be relevant despite the rapidly evolving tech landscape. **
